  • Abstract
    A new method is given for solving the large sparse system of linear algebraic equations Ax = b which arises in three-dimensional finite element problems. It combines incomplete frontal factorization with the preconditioned conjugate gradient technique. The resulting hybrid method makes large three-dimensional problems feasible even with limited computer memory, since it automatically trades memory for execution time. Thus as problems become larger computing times increase dramatically but solution is still possible.
